Q: Is 361,131,275 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 361,131,275 is a composite number.

Why is 361,131,275 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 361,131,275 can be evenly divided by 1 5 25 14,445,251 72,226,255 and 361,131,275, with no remainder.

Since 361,131,275 cannot be divided by just 1 and 361,131,275, it is a composite number.
